    The article focuses on the problematic of temperature dependence of deactivation of native N-Methyl-D-Aspartate (NMDA) receptors in neuronal cultures and the temperature dependence of excitatory postsynaptic currents mediated by synaptic NMDA receptors in rat cortical slices. Our electrophysiology experiments found that both native as well as synaptic receptors exhibit significantly weaker temperature dependence compared to recombinant GluN1/GluN2B NMDA receptors. Synaptic NMDA receptors have characteristics of receptors with low desensitization (20%). Double exponential time course of NMDA receptor deactivation originates mainly from dissociation of agonist and desensitization
